Thursday Night Trading Aids M. & Choyce

(N Z. Press Association) . AUCKLAND, October 14. Sales at the main store of George Court and Sons, Ltd, at Karangahape Road show “a very substantial increase since balance-date” compared with the corresponding period last year. The chairman (Mr J. W. Coney) told shareholders this at the annual meeting today. The most significant influence on last year’s result was the sales and profit performance of the Karangahape Road store. As previously reported, the company lifted net profit by $33,644, or 48 per cent, to a peak $103,793 in the year to July 19. In reply to a question from a shareholder, Mr Coney said that Thursday night late shopping had greatly assisted the company’s trading.
